news 2026/6/9 19:56:36

Spyder终极配置指南:5步搭建高效Python科学计算环境

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Spyder终极配置指南:5步搭建高效Python科学计算环境

Spyder终极配置指南:5步搭建高效Python科学计算环境

【免费下载链接】spyderOfficial repository for Spyder - The Scientific Python Development Environment项目地址: https://gitcode.com/gh_mirrors/sp/spyder

Spyder作为专业的科学Python开发环境,为数据分析和机器学习提供了完整的工具链。无论您是Python新手还是资深开发者,都能通过本指南快速掌握Spyder的核心配置技巧,打造个性化的开发工作空间。

🎯 为什么Spyder是科学计算的首选?

Spyder专为科学计算优化,提供直观的变量探索、实时代码测试和可视化集成。其多面板设计让您同时查看代码、变量和图表,显著提升数据分析效率。

📋 准备工作与环境检查

在开始配置前,请确保您的系统满足以下要求:

  • Python 3.7或更高版本
  • 至少4GB可用内存
  • 支持的操作系统:Windows、macOS或Linux

🚀 快速安装Spyder的三种方式

方法一:Anaconda一站式安装

通过Anaconda安装是最简单的方式,自动处理所有依赖关系:

conda install spyder

方法二:pip直接安装

如果您已有Python环境:

pip install spyder

方法三:源码编译安装

获取最新功能,从源码构建:

git clone https://gitcode.com/gh_mirrors/sp/spyder cd spyder pip install -e .

⚙️ 5步核心配置流程

第一步:首次启动与界面熟悉

运行命令启动Spyder:

spyder

首次启动后,您将看到包含多个功能面板的主界面:左侧是代码编辑器,右侧是变量浏览器,底部是IPython控制台。

第二步:Python解释器配置

  1. 进入ToolsPreferences
  2. 选择Python interpreter选项卡
  3. 指定Python解释器路径或使用系统默认

第三步:工作目录设置

在右下角的Working Directory面板中设置项目工作路径,确保文件操作和导入的正确性。

第四步:主题与外观个性化

根据个人喜好调整界面风格:

  • 进入Appearance设置
  • 选择深色或浅色主题
  • 调整字体大小和样式

第五步:插件功能激活

Spyder的插件系统提供丰富的扩展功能:

  • Variable Explorer:实时查看和编辑变量
  • Plots:管理图表和可视化输出
  • Profiler:分析代码性能瓶颈
  • Pylint:检查代码质量和规范

🔧 高级功能深度配置

变量浏览器专业设置

Variable Explorer是Spyder的亮点功能,支持:

  • 查看NumPy数组、Pandas DataFrame等数据结构
  • 实时编辑变量值
  • 支持大文件数据预览

IPython控制台优化

配置交互式控制台提升开发体验:

  • 启用自动补全功能
  • 设置命令历史记录
  • 配置魔法命令支持

代码编辑器增强

优化代码编写环境:

  • 语法高亮和代码折叠
  • 实时错误检查和提示
  • 集成调试器设置

📊 实战工作流程示例

数据分析项目配置

  1. 创建新项目并设置工作目录
  2. 通过requirements/main.yml管理项目依赖
  3. 配置代码风格和质量检查

机器学习实验设置

利用Spyder进行机器学习开发:

  • 数据预处理和特征工程
  • 模型训练和评估
  • 结果可视化和分析

💡 常见配置问题解决方案

安装依赖冲突处理

如果遇到包冲突问题:

  • 使用虚拟环境隔离项目
  • 检查Python版本兼容性
  • 更新到最新版本的Spyder

性能优化技巧

提升Spyder运行效率:

  • 关闭不必要的插件
  • 优化内存使用设置
  • 定期清理缓存文件

🎉 开始您的科学计算之旅

完成以上配置后,您的Spyder环境已经准备就绪。现在可以:

  • 编写和测试数据分析代码
  • 利用变量浏览器深入理解数据结构
  • 通过图表面板创建专业可视化
  • 使用IPython控制台进行交互式实验

Spyder的强大功能将让您的Python科学计算工作更加高效和愉悦。立即开始探索这个优秀的开发环境,发现更多实用功能!

通过本指南的详细步骤,您已经掌握了Spyder的核心配置方法。记住,良好的开发环境配置是高效编程的第一步,花时间优化您的工具将带来长期的回报。

【免费下载链接】spyderOfficial repository for Spyder - The Scientific Python Development Environment项目地址: https://gitcode.com/gh_mirrors/sp/spyder

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 8:47:13

如何快速掌握tiny11builder:Windows 11精简系统制作的终极指南

还在为Windows 11的臃肿运行速度而烦恼吗?每次开机都要面对一堆用不上的预装应用?系统盘空间频频告急?别担心,今天我要分享一个神奇的解决方案——tiny11builder,让你的Windows 11脱胎换骨,运行如飞&#x…

作者头像 李华
网站建设 2026/6/6 5:13:02

Linux动态桌面美化终极指南:从静态到动态的华丽蜕变

Linux动态桌面美化终极指南:从静态到动态的华丽蜕变 【免费下载链接】linux-wallpaperengine Wallpaper Engine backgrounds for Linux! 项目地址: https://gitcode.com/gh_mirrors/li/linux-wallpaperengine 厌倦了千篇一律的静态桌面背景?想要为…

作者头像 李华
网站建设 2026/6/8 12:43:28

iOSDeviceSupport终极指南:解决Xcode设备调试兼容性问题

iOSDeviceSupport终极指南:解决Xcode设备调试兼容性问题 【免费下载链接】iOSDeviceSupport All versions of iOS Device Support 项目地址: https://gitcode.com/gh_mirrors/ios/iOSDeviceSupport 还在为Xcode无法识别设备而烦恼吗?iOSDeviceSup…

作者头像 李华
网站建设 2026/6/6 14:38:43

VSCode R语言开发环境配置全攻略:打造高效数据分析工作流

VSCode R语言开发环境配置全攻略:打造高效数据分析工作流 【免费下载链接】vscode-R R Extension for Visual Studio Code 项目地址: https://gitcode.com/gh_mirrors/vs/vscode-R 还在为RStudio的界面单调而苦恼?想要在现代化的代码编辑器中体验…

作者头像 李华
网站建设 2026/5/29 14:32:32

为什么m3u8下载工具MediaGo成为在线视频下载的首选方案?

为什么m3u8下载工具MediaGo成为在线视频下载的首选方案? 【免费下载链接】m3u8-downloader m3u8 视频在线提取工具 流媒体下载 m3u8下载 桌面客户端 windows mac 项目地址: https://gitcode.com/gh_mirrors/m3u8/m3u8-downloader 还在为无法保存心爱的在线视…

作者头像 李华
网站建设 2026/6/1 3:10:37

Noita联机新纪元:3大核心技术带你开启完美多人魔法冒险

Noita联机新纪元:3大核心技术带你开启完美多人魔法冒险 【免费下载链接】noita_entangled_worlds An experimental true coop multiplayer mod for Noita. 项目地址: https://gitcode.com/gh_mirrors/no/noita_entangled_worlds 还在独自探索Noita的混沌世界…

作者头像 李华